In today's rapidly advancing world, technology plays a crucial role in enhancing our daily lives. One of the remarkable innovations that have emerged in recent years is the automatic temperature control device. This device has become increasingly popular in various applications, from residential heating and cooling systems to industrial processes. Understanding the significance and functionality of the automatic temperature control device can help us appreciate how it improves comfort and efficiency in our environments.The primary function of an automatic temperature control device is to maintain a desired temperature within a specified range. It achieves this by using sensors to detect the current temperature and then adjusting the heating or cooling output accordingly. For instance, in a home setting, a thermostat acts as an automatic temperature control device by regulating the indoor climate based on the homeowner's preferences. When the temperature rises above the set point, the device activates the air conditioning system; conversely, if the temperature drops too low, it turns on the heating system.The advantages of using an automatic temperature control device are manifold. Firstly, it promotes energy efficiency. By maintaining a consistent temperature, these devices minimize energy waste, leading to lower utility bills. In commercial buildings, for example, the implementation of automatic temperature control devices can significantly reduce heating and cooling costs, which is essential for businesses looking to optimize their operational expenses.Secondly, the comfort level in living and working spaces is greatly enhanced by the use of automatic temperature control devices. Individuals are more productive and feel better when they are in a comfortable environment. Furthermore, many modern automatic temperature control devices come equipped with smart technology, allowing users to control them remotely via smartphones or other devices. This feature adds an extra layer of convenience, enabling homeowners to adjust their home’s temperature even when they are away.Moreover, automatic temperature control devices are also vital in industrial settings where precise temperature regulation is necessary for processes such as manufacturing and food preservation. In these scenarios, fluctuations in temperature can lead to product spoilage or equipment malfunction, making reliable temperature control essential. By employing automatic temperature control devices, industries can ensure quality control and enhance productivity.Despite their numerous benefits, there are challenges associated with automatic temperature control devices. Installation and maintenance costs can be high, especially for advanced systems that integrate with smart home technology. Additionally, users must understand how to operate these devices effectively to maximize their potential benefits. Education and awareness about the proper usage of automatic temperature control devices are crucial for achieving optimal results.In conclusion, the automatic temperature control device is an invaluable tool in today’s world, providing comfort, efficiency, and reliability across various settings. As technology continues to evolve, we can expect even more sophisticated temperature control solutions that will further enhance our quality of life. Embracing these innovations not only helps us save energy and reduce costs but also allows us to create more comfortable and productive environments for ourselves and future generations.
